Arsenal: Ramsdale; White, Saliba, Gabriel, Tierney (Nketiah, d. 61); Elneny, Xhaka; Saka, Odegaard (Holding, d. 95), Martinelli; Gabriel Jesus (Tomiyasu, d. 88).
Fulham: log; Tete (Issa Diop, d. 79), Adariaboyo, Ream, Robinson; Reed, Palhinha; De Cordova-Reid, Andreas Pereira (Mbabu, d. 79), Neeskens Kebano (Cairney, d. 70); Mitrovic.
The objectives: 0-1, m. 55: Mitrović. 1-1, m. 63: Odegaard. 2-1, m. 87: Gabriel.
Referee: Jared Gilbert. He advised locals White (m. 36) and Gabriel Jesús (m. 44) and visitors Palhinha (m. 44), Robinson (m. 51) and De Cordova-Reid (m. 70).
Incidents: match corresponding to the fourth day of the ‘Premier League’, played at the Emirates Stadium in London in front of around 60,000 spectators.

They had to overcome the ‘gunners’ Mitrovic’s goal put them on the ropes, however goals from Odegaard and Gabriel Magalhaes led to a comeback that allowed them to continue at the top with many victories.
goalless soccer
Arsenal’s first half was a festival of arrivals and occasions to score. Arteta’s team has all the colors, repeatedly crashing into the wall erected by Bernd Leno, his exporter after being sold this summer to Fulham.
The German goalkeeper has a great responsibility for the game to reach the break without a goal, as Arsenal are vastly superior to Fulham all the time.
Gift of Arsenal
The script in the second half was the same, with some ‘gunners’ surrounding Leno’s goal, but what they didn’t expect was the gift of Gabriel Magalhaes a Mitrović. The Brazilian central defender let his wallet be stolen and the Fulham striker put his team ahead (57′).
The joy didn’t last long for Fulham, because Martin Odegaard is sweet and proved the tie with a rather lucky shot (64′).
Magalhaes redeems himself
Arsenal turned for more, but he is lucky to have Ramsdale to prevent greater evils. The ‘gunner’ goalkeeper supported his team with his saves and gave time for Gabriel Magalhaes will find the redemption.
The centre-back managed to make amends for his mistake by scoring the winning goal of Arsenal coming out of a corner and coincidentally keeping his team in the lead. These are four victories in a row for some ‘gunners’ like a fluke.
